site stats

Byte write enable

Web// Documentation Portal . Resources Developer Site; Xilinx Wiki; Xilinx Github; Support Support Community WebJan 4, 2024 · for a read/write to a UVM_FIELD, there's a complex computation of byte_en for the whole field , then another computation to extract the correct bus byte enable from the whole field byte_enable. Those 2 computations seems correct to me but the last assignemnt "rw_access.byte_en = byte_en;" breaks everything by systematically setting …

Xilinx DS444 Block RAM (BRAM) Block (v1.00a), Data Sheet

WebSep 30, 2015 · This is where 1) the byte addressing mode and 2) the immediate offset of memory addresses in the new read/write instructions help a lot. The general method for transmitting a byte over the UART is as follows: Wait until the ready bit is set. Set the data input value. Set the transmit signal bit. WebThe byte write enables are also used in x1, x2, x4, x5, x8, x10, x16, and x20 widths to select the operational mode (read/write) for a Port A or Port B. If all byte write enables are low, then Port A or Port B is considered to be in read mode and any read operations are … does the army need nurses https://mayaraguimaraes.com

2.2.4. Byte Enable - Intel

WebByte Enable. To ensure that the operation writes only specific bytes of data, embedded memory blocks support the byte enable property, that masks the input data. The … WebFunction for checking whether a byte is writable at the specified address. More... void nrfx_nvmc_byte_write (uint32_t address, uint8_t value) Function for writing a single byte to flash. More... bool nrfx_nvmc_halfword_writable_check (uint32_t address, uint16_t value) Function for checking whether a halfword is writable at the specified address. WebI can't seem to find a way to include a write enable. Thanks. This is the general template I have been using to infer dual port brams so far. If there is a better way I would love to know. module bram_tdp #( parameter DATA = 72, parameter ADDR = 10 ) ( // Port A input wire a_clk, input wire a_wr, input wire [ADDR-1:0] a_addr, input wire [DATA-1 ... does the army have sports

verilog - Xilinx:Reading from BRAM - Stack Overflow

Category:(PDF) BIST enhancement for detecting bit/byte write …

Tags:Byte write enable

Byte write enable

verilog - Xilinx:Reading from BRAM - Stack Overflow

WebRAMB primitive in architectures prior to Virtex-4 on ly have a single write enable per port. Thus if byte-write enable is required on a 32 bit data port (C_NUM_WE=4), these architectures will use a minimum of 4 BRAM primitives. Table 3: Parameter-Port Dependencies Name Affects Depends Relationship Description Design Parameters … WebDec 9, 2008 · This paper presents an experiment in diagnosing defects in the circuitry responsible for the realization of bit, byte or group write enable in memories. First defects in such circuitry are...

Byte write enable

Did you know?

WebMar 2015 - Jul 20243 years 5 months. I design and architect the firmware for our gaming products. As well as assist in hardware development, manufacturing processes, board bring-up, hardware ... WebHi, currently I am working on a MAC to AXI Lite interface and one part of the AXI Lite interface requires writes to include a byte wide enable on a 32 bit data bus. I was easily …

WebThe data word to be written is controlled by (a) a global write enable GWE, which enables or disables the word to be written, and (b) bit write enables BWEi which are associated one-to-one... WebJul 2, 2024 · Some schemes have a byte lane enable (for writes, reads you generally read the whole width of the bus 16, or 32 or 64, whatever) and thus when writing (a byte) to address 0x1000 or 0x1001 you can put 0x1000 or even better 0x800 on the address bus then use the byte lane enables to indicate which lanes are being written one or the other …

WebThe data word to be written is controlled by (a) a global write enable GWE, which enables or disables the word to be written, and (b) bit write enables BWEi which are associated … WebWRITE DRIVERS UPPER BYTE WRITE ENABLE LOWER BYTE WRITE ENABLE W BYTE ENABLE BUFFER UB A[19:0] 10 10 16 8 8 8 8 8 16 8 8 DQL[7:0] 8 DQU[15:8] LB UPPER BYTE WRITE DRIVER UB LB 1. DEVICE PIN ASSIGNMENT Figure 1.1 Block Diagram Table 1.1 Pin Functions Signal Name Function A Address Input E Chip Enable …

Webwrite enable (WE; W) The input that, when true, causes the data present on the D or the DQ pin (s) to be written into the address cell (s) of the device. For devices that have one …

WebApr 12, 2024 · 1, Byte Write Enable 怎么用. 2, vivado bram 中的 width 与 depth 设置注意事项. 3, Vivado使用心得(四)IP核BRAM的实用功能. 分类: Xilinx FPGA开发. 好文要顶 关注我 收藏该文. does the army or marines go in firstWebMar 5, 2024 · port0_wdata: write data; port0_wben: write byte enable; port0_rdata: read data; SRAMs use a latency sensitive interface meaning a user must carefully manage the timing for correct operation (i.e., set the … does the army need officersWebThe Intel Agilex® 7 embedded memory blocks support byte enable controls. The byte enable controls mask the input data so that only specific bytes of data are written. The unwritten bytes retain the values written previously. The write enable ( wren) signal, together with the byte enable ( byteena) signal, control the write operations on the ... facility decommissioningWebThe byte write enables are also used in x1, x2, x4, x5, x8, x10, x16, and x20 widths to select the operational mode (read/write) for a Port A or Port B. ... Table 1 lists the byte write enable settings for Port A and Port B. Table 1. Byte Write Enables Settings for Dual-Port Mode ; Depth x Width A_WEN / B_WEN Result; 16K x 1, 8K x 2, 4K x 4, 4K ... does the army pay for college debtWebJan 31, 2012 · Byte enables are generally directly supported. You can view the Xilinx coding guidelines here where it describes byte enables on page 159. Share Improve this answer Follow answered Jan 31, 2012 at 20:55 user597225 Add a comment Your Answer By clicking “Post Your Answer”, you agree to our terms of service, privacy policy and cookie … facility definitonWebTo enable byte-wide writes on port A, specify the byte width, in bits. • 8- 8-bit byte-wide writes, legal when WRITE_DATA_WIDTH_A is an integer multiple of 8 • 9- 9-bit byte-wide writes, legal when WRITE_DATA_WIDTH_A is an integer multiple of 9 Or to enable word-wide writes on port A, specify the same value as for WRITE_DATA_WIDTH_A facility definition under section 503bWebJun 16, 2024 · // Documentation Portal . Resources Developer Site; Xilinx Wiki; Xilinx Github; Support Support Community does the army need soldiers